People Are Coming Out As Berris**ual – Here’s What It Means

Across queer communities online, new language continues to emerge to describe the full spectrum of attraction.

For many, discovering a word that captures their experience can feel like a relief, almost like finding a missing puzzle piece.

In recent months, one of those words has been gaining traction: berris**ual.

While still relatively unknown compared to terms like bis**ual or pans**ual, berris**ual is slowly making its way into conversations on platforms such as Reddit, Tumblr, and LGBTQ+ wikis, where users are celebrating the label and what it represents.

On Reddit, the identity has been introduced with both humor and pride. In one post on r/bis**ual, a user joked about what the ‘berris**ual flag as a person’ might look like, pairing the lighthearted description with pride emojis.

Elsewhere, in r/lgbt, people have been more direct about their enthusiasm.

One user wrote: “Berris**ual representation! ,” while another added: “Many people don’t know about berris**ual, and we need more representation!”

For those who feel that traditional labels like bis**ual or omnis**ual don’t quite capture their experience, having a new term that resonates can be empowering.

The sense of recognition is echoed across other threads. In r/omnis**ual, one poster explained how they had struggled to decide between calling themselves omnis**ual or neptunic, but then found that berris**ual felt more accurate.

“Now I don’t have to pick because berri fits like a glove,” they wrote.

Another user admitted that while they identify as berris**ual, they sometimes tell people they are omnis**ual because it is simpler to explain.
